Note
  1. Opera in two acts.
  2. Libretto by Joseph Sonnleithner and Georg Friedrich Treitschke, after Jean-Nicolas Bouilly.
  3. This recording is taken from concert performances at the Berlin Philharmonie, following staged performances of Fidelio at the Salzburg Easter Festival 2003 in the production by Nikolaus Lehnhoff.
